What you need to know about Germany’s degree

In the German education system,

  • Bachelor of arts equals 6 semesters of study.
  • Master of arts, 2-4 depending on the program.
  • PhD equals 4-6 depending on the program.

Top Ranked German Institutions In The Field Of Fashion Designing.

  1. Fashion design institute in Dusseldorf AMD Hamburg – Private: voted among the best 50 international fashion schools year after year by Forbes magazine. It offers courses in fashion design, fashion management/marketing, Journalism. Click to visit the official school website>>https://www.amdnet.de/en/
  2. Kunsthochschulee Weissensee – Non profit Public: Kuntsthochschule Weissensee is a non profit public school in Berlin. It was founded in 1946 with over 850 students.Click to visit the official school website>>https://www.kh-berlin.de/
  3. Humboldt University in BerlinNon profit Public:  established in 1810, it is one of the oldest fashion institutions in Germany. It is a public research university in Mitte, Berlin. Click to visit the official school website>>https://www.hu-berlin.de/de
  4. Brand university of applied sciences – Private: founded in 2010, Brand university of applied sciences is a government recognized institution located in Hamburg. Tuition fees ranges from 257.50EUR ( domestic) to 345.40 EUR ( international). Click to visit the official school website>>http://www.brand-university.de/
  5. Burg Gebichenstein school for fashion and design, Halle – Non profit Public:  one of the largest universities of arts and design.The university offers about 20 art and design degree programmes in two faculties. It was established in 1915. Click to visit the official school website>>http://www.burg-halle.de/

Requirements For Application

Some basic requirements to consider before applying to a fashion schools in Germany includes;

It is important for you to check that your current qualifications are recognized by your chosen university before you apply

Check the language requirements of the institution whether programs are taught in German or English

Finance– public institutions are less expensive, there are also scholarships, student loans and grants to assist students with inadequate finances.

You would also be required to present a copy of your your certified high school diploma or previous degrees.

Health insurance.

Passports, especially if you are an international student.

The cost of living in Germany is rather affordable for a student even as an international student.

First of all, the German education system provides almost free education where the majority of the universities don’t require tuition fees for either natives or international students because they are funded by the government. However, tuition fees for private universities are also affordable.

In Germany you can choose between public and private health insurance, but the public health insurance is more affordable.

It is rare to come by any university that will ever accept you without the health insurance papers submitted.
